DC Pandey's Objective Physics for NEET, published by Arihant Publications, is a cornerstone resource for medical aspirants aiming for high scores in the NEET Physics section. The series is split into two volumes—Volume 1 for Class 11 and Volume 2 for Class 12—and is praised for its modular approach that balances concise theory with a vast repository of exam-style questions. Book Structure and Key Features

The books are meticulously aligned with the NCERT curriculum, making them suitable for simultaneous board and entrance exam preparation.

Modular Theory: Each chapter is divided into logical subtopics. These sections start with detailed explanations, key formulas, graphs, and figures before moving to examples.

Part A (Taking it Together): Objective questions arranged by difficulty level for systematic practice.

Part B (Medical Entrance Special Format): Covers specific question types frequently asked in NEET, including assertion-reason and match-the-column.

Step 1: Don't Read Theory from DC Pandey. Read NCERT First.

DC Pandey’s theory is condensed. Use it only for revision. For first-time learning, NCERT is the bible. Read a chapter from NCERT, then open DC Pandey to see how they ask MCQs on the same topic.
